Global Outsourced Manufacturing Smartwatch Shipments Rose 15% YoY in H2 2022
- Luxshare was the top outsourced smartwatch manufacturer in H2 2022 as it undertook around 40% of Apple Watch production.
- In Tier-2, Huaqin ranked first as it produced smartwatches from a variety of brands. Meanwhile, LINWEAR, I DO and Yawell benefitted from the stellar growth of Indian brands.
- The share of outsourced manufacturing shipments is expected to continue to grow as the global smartwatch market expands.
Beijing, New Delhi, Hong Kong, Taipei, Seoul, San Diego, Buenos Aires, London – May. 2023
Global smartwatch outsourced manufactured shipments increased 15% YoY and accounted for 69% of overall global shipments in H2 2022, according to Counterpoint Research’s latest Global Smartwatch Outsourced Manufacturing Tracker and Report. Senior Research Analyst Shenghao Bai said, “The YoY increase in outsourced smartwatch shipments in H2 2022 was driven by the strong performance of Indian brands Noise, Fire-Boltt and boAt. The outsourced manufacturers who offered production services for these brands benefited in H2 2022.” Bai added, “As global smartwatch shipments continue to grow, the contribution of outsourced manufacturing sources has also increased. 69% of global smartwatches were produced by ODM/EMS in H2 2022, compared with 63% in H2 2021.” Luxshare, Foxconn and COMPAL were the top three outsourced manufacturers in H2 2022. The three players were responsible for half of the global smartwatch outsourced shipments during the period. Luxshare ranked first in H2 2022 as it undertook around 40% of Apple Watch orders. Among Tier-2 players, Huaqin, LINWEAR, I DO and Yawell displayed strong performances in their smartwatch production businesses.
